Air conditioning is not a solution to a hot house. It’s a treatment for the symptom. Real relief — and typically lower running bills — comes from the envelope: roof, walls, glass and shading.

Insulated roofs and west-side shading usually do more for top-floor comfort than oversizing outdoor AC units. Double-glazed windows with an appropriate solar-heat-gain coefficient cut unwanted gain; exact performance depends on glass spec and orientation, which belong on the architectural drawings.

None of this is exotic — it’s choices many builders skip because clients don’t ask. Ask for roof assembly, glazing spec and shading on the drawing set before you approve it.

In Islamabad’s climate, unshaded west-facing glazing on upper floors is a common comfort problem. Combine appropriate glass with roof insulation before the waterproofing layer — not as a later overlay on a hot slab.

Ventilation strategy matters as much as insulation: stack ventilation through stair cores and high-level exhaust can reduce AC hours even when outdoor humidity is high. We take these decisions in architectural stage — retrofitting later means breaking finished ceilings.
